什么是V2Ray?
V2Ray是一个功能强大的代理工具,支持多种协议,可以帮助用户在网络中进行匿名和加密通信。它被广泛用于科学上网、绕过网络封锁以及保护用户隐私。
V2Ray全局代理的优势
- 隐私保护:V2Ray可以加密用户的网络流量,保护用户隐私。
- 突破限制:可以有效突破地域限制,访问被封锁的网站。
- 灵活性:支持多种传输协议和路由策略。
环境准备
在开始安装之前,请确保你的Linux系统已连接到互联网,并且具有sudo权限。
安装V2Ray
1. 下载V2Ray
首先,你需要从V2Ray的官方GitHub页面下载最新的版本。使用以下命令: bash bash <(curl -s -L https://git.io/v2ray.sh)
2. 安装V2Ray
下载完成后,运行安装命令: bash sudo bash v2ray-install.sh
根据提示完成安装。
配置V2Ray全局代理
1. 修改配置文件
V2Ray的配置文件通常位于 /etc/v2ray/config.json
,使用以下命令打开文件: bash sudo nano /etc/v2ray/config.json
在文件中添加或修改以下字段:
- outbounds:配置出口。你可以设置为
vmess
或其他协议。 - inbounds:配置入口。一般默认即可。
2. 启动V2Ray
完成配置后,使用以下命令启动V2Ray服务: bash sudo systemctl start v2ray
并设置开机自启: bash sudo systemctl enable v2ray
设置全局代理
1. 配置代理
在Linux系统中,可以通过修改环境变量来设置全局代理。打开终端,输入: bash export http_proxy=’http://127.0.0.1:1080′ export https_proxy=’http://127.0.0.1:1080′
根据你V2Ray的配置,1080是默认的本地代理端口。
2. 使设置永久生效
你可以将以上的export命令添加到你的 ~/.bashrc
或 ~/.bash_profile
文件中,确保每次登录都自动加载。
检测代理是否生效
可以使用 curl
命令测试代理: bash curl -I https://www.google.com
如果返回正常的HTTP头信息,则表示代理设置成功。
常见问题解答(FAQ)
Q1: V2Ray全局代理安全吗?
A1: 是的,V2Ray通过加密用户的流量,可以有效保护用户的隐私。但请注意,选择可靠的V2Ray服务器也是关键。
Q2: 如何知道V2Ray是否正常工作?
A2: 你可以查看V2Ray的日志,使用命令 sudo journalctl -u v2ray
查看是否有错误信息,或访问被封锁的网站进行测试。
Q3: 如何停止或重启V2Ray服务?
A3: 使用以下命令: bash sudo systemctl stop v2ray sudo systemctl restart v2ray
Q4: 如何卸载V2Ray?
A4: 如果需要卸载V2Ray,可以使用: bash sudo bash /etc/v2ray/uninstall.sh
结论
V2Ray作为一款强大的全局代理工具,能够有效帮助用户保护隐私和绕过网络封锁。通过本文提供的安装和配置步骤,你可以轻松在Linux上设置V2Ray全局代理,享受安全畅快的网络体验。希望本文对你有所帮助!